summaryrefslogtreecommitdiff
path: root/six.py
diff options
context:
space:
mode:
authorMirko Rossini <isaidyep@gmail.com>2014-10-21 13:07:05 -0400
committerMirko Rossini <isaidyep@gmail.com>2014-10-21 13:07:05 -0400
commit92f3fe9612c2ebf6ffdb7752dd8a26d1f6edc4b4 (patch)
tree65bc944e9859db769c70957743a23f7c145b37ff /six.py
parentebe2cd1761a7da32e3fb24fdc53b80914ab1d300 (diff)
downloadsix-git-92f3fe9612c2ebf6ffdb7752dd8a26d1f6edc4b4.tar.gz
_winreg is added to the moves module under windows only
Diffstat (limited to 'six.py')
-rw-r--r--six.py6
1 files changed, 5 insertions, 1 deletions
diff --git a/six.py b/six.py
index 232a0c7..06c8bd7 100644
--- a/six.py
+++ b/six.py
@@ -292,8 +292,12 @@ _moved_attributes = [
MovedModule("urllib_robotparser", "robotparser", "urllib.robotparser"),
MovedModule("xmlrpc_client", "xmlrpclib", "xmlrpc.client"),
MovedModule("xmlrpc_server", "SimpleXMLRPCServer", "xmlrpc.server"),
- MovedModule("winreg", "_winreg"),
]
+#Add windows specific modules if needed
+if sys.platform in ('win32', 'cygwin'):
+ _moved_attributes += [
+ MovedModule("winreg", "_winreg"),
+ ]
for attr in _moved_attributes:
setattr(_MovedItems, attr.name, attr)
if isinstance(attr, MovedModule):